What is Chocks?
Chocks play a vital role in steel production, particularly in continuous casting and rolling mills. They are designed to support the rolls, ensuring proper alignment during operation. In continuous casting steel mills, roll chocks provide essential stability as molten steel is shaped into semi-finished products. This stability is crucial for maintaining the quality of the final output.
In rolling mills, chocks help absorb forces exerted during the rolling process, preventing misalignment and vibrations. This is important for producing uniform and high-quality steel products. Additionally, roll chocks facilitate quick adjustments and maintenance, enhancing overall efficiency in manufacturing operations. Their robust design is essential for withstanding the high pressures and temperatures involved in steel processing.

What are features of Chocks ?
Structural Integrity
Both roll chocks in continuous casting and rolling mills are engineered for high strength and durability. They are designed to withstand extreme forces and temperatures, ensuring stable support for rolls. This structural integrity prevents deformation and extends the lifespan of the equipment.
Precision Alignment
Roll chocks ensure precise alignment of the rolls during operation. In continuous casting, this alignment is critical for shaping molten steel accurately. In rolling mills, it maintains consistent product dimensions, reducing defects and enhancing overall product quality.
Vibration Absorption
Chocks play a key role in absorbing vibrations generated during the rolling process. This capability minimizes disruptions, allowing for smoother operation in both continuous casting and rolling mills, which is essential for maintaining high production rates and quality.
Maintenance Accessibility
Both types of chocks are designed for easy access, facilitating quick adjustments and maintenance. This feature is vital in minimizing downtime during operations. Efficient maintenance practices ensure optimal performance and longevity of the rolling and casting processes.
Heat Resistance
Chocks are constructed from materials that can endure high temperatures, particularly in continuous casting operations. This heat resistance is crucial for maintaining performance and preventing thermal deformation, ensuring that the chocks remain effective under extreme conditions.
Customization Options
Chocks can be tailored to specific applications and operational requirements. Whether for continuous casting or rolling mills, customization allows for adjustments in size, weight, and design to meet unique production needs, enhancing overall efficiency and effectiveness.
What are the main Material of Chocks ?
Cast Chocks
Cast chocks are produced by pouring molten metal into a mold, where it cools and solidifies into the desired shape. The casting process allows for intricate designs, making it suitable for creating chocks with complex geometries. Cast chocks typically have a uniform grain structure, but they can sometimes contain impurities or porosity, which may affect their strength. Common materials used for cast chocks include cast iron or cast steel, offering good wear resistance and durability, particularly in static applications like securing heavy machinery.
Forged Chocks
Forged chocks are made through a process of applying high pressure to heated metal, shaping it into a denser and stronger form. This method improves the material’s internal structure, eliminating voids and increasing the overall mechanical properties, such as toughness and impact resistance. Forged chocks are typically more durable than cast versions, as the grain flow follows the contour of the shape, which enhances their load-bearing capacity. They are commonly made from high-strength steel or alloy steel, making them ideal for dynamic applications where reliability and strength are critical.
What are the Applications of Chocks?
In a continuous casting machine, chocks are used to support the rollers that guide and shape the molten metal as it solidifies. They provide stable, precise alignment for the rolls, ensuring smooth material flow and preventing damage to the equipment. Chocks in this context must handle high temperatures and stresses while maintaining alignment to prevent production defects.
In hot rolling mills, chocks house the bearings that support the rolls as they compress heated metal into thinner sheets. These chocks must withstand extreme temperatures, high pressures, and heavy loads while maintaining the proper alignment of rolls. Durability and heat resistance are essential for chocks in hot rolling operations to ensure continuous, reliable performance.
Chocks in cold rolling mills support the rolls that reduce metal thickness at ambient temperatures. Since cold rolling requires higher forces due to the harder material, the chocks need to be robust, ensuring stable alignment and bearing support. The precise positioning provided by the chocks contributes to achieving tight tolerances and smooth surface finishes in the rolled product.
In temper mills, chocks support the rolls that impart a light reduction to improve flatness, surface finish, and mechanical properties of the rolled sheet. Chocks ensure the rolls maintain consistent pressure and alignment during this process. They play a crucial role in providing uniform tension and controlling surface defects in the final product.
In a skin pass rolling mill, chocks hold the work rolls that apply a small reduction to improve surface texture and mechanical properties of metal sheets. The chocks ensure accurate positioning and load distribution for the rolls, providing a consistent surface finish. They must handle high precision and minimal deformation to meet the stringent quality requirements of the end product.
Maintenance Tips for Chocks?
Regular Inspection
Periodic inspections are essential to identify wear, misalignments, or cracks in chocks. Carefully check the surface condition, lubrication ports, and bearings to ensure smooth operation. Early detection of damage helps avoid costly downtime and improves the lifespan of both the chocks and associated machinery.

Proper Lubrication
Ensuring the chocks are adequately lubricated is critical to minimizing friction and wear. Using the correct type of lubricant is essential for maintaining the smooth operation of chocks under high pressure and extreme temperatures. This practice prevents premature failure and extends the operational life of the chocks.

Alignment Checks
Regularly verify the alignment of chocks with the rolling or casting rolls. Misalignment can cause uneven wear, increased stress on bearings, and potential equipment failure. Properly aligned chocks help maintain consistent product quality and reduce the risk of damaging the roll stands.

Timely Replacement of Worn Components
Bearings, seals, and other components within the chocks are subject to wear over time. Timely replacement of these parts is necessary to prevent more severe damage to the chock housing or associated machinery. Delaying component replacement may lead to expensive repairs and increased downtime.

What is the process of Chocks?
Design and Engineering
The process begins with designing the chocks based on the specific requirements of the mill, such as load capacity and operational conditions. Engineers create detailed CAD drawings and specifications to ensure the chocks meet the mill’s mechanical and operational standards, optimizing durability and precision.
Material Selection
High-quality steel or cast iron is selected for the chock’s construction to withstand extreme stress and temperature fluctuations. The chosen material must exhibit excellent strength, fatigue resistance, and wear properties to endure continuous use in harsh industrial environments without deforming or failing.
Casting or Forging
The raw material undergoes casting or forging to form the basic structure of the chock. In casting, molten metal is poured into a mold and allowed to solidify, while forging involves shaping the material under high pressure. Both processes are designed to create a strong, solid base for further machining.
Machining and Finishing
Once the rough structure is formed, precision machining is performed to achieve the final dimensions. This step includes boring, grinding, and surface finishing to ensure the chock meets the precise tolerances required for smooth roll operation. After machining, the chock is inspected and tested to ensure quality before being installed in the mill.
Inspection
After machining and finishing, chocks undergo a rigorous inspection process to ensure they meet strict quality and performance standards. This includes dimensional checks, non-destructive testing (NDT) for internal defects, and surface finish evaluations. Any deviations from the specifications are corrected before final approval. Inspection ensures that the chocks are reliable, durable, and safe for use in demanding industrial applications.
Packing
Once inspected and approved, the chocks are carefully packed for transportation. Proper packing protects them from damage during handling and shipping, ensuring they arrive in perfect condition at the installation site. Packaging typically includes protective coatings to prevent rust and cushioning materials to prevent impact during transit, especially for heavy and precision-machined components.
